New Issue of Specusphere PDF Print E-mail

A new issue of The Specusphere is now available: http://www.specusphere.com

Our editorial takes on the thorny question of what to do about self-publishers who by-pass editors.


". if a novel has not been edited then it is, essentially, nothing more than
a glorified manuscript-in-progress ."

Also:

a.. Our reviewers give their opinion about what they thought were the best books of 2009
b.. Brendan Carson gives us more other-worldly cogitation
c.. Alan Baxter wonders about the iPad
d.. Damien Kane speculates on the imagination

In other sections, Astrid Cooper enthralls us with chats and interviews with people of the genre: Sue Bursztynski, Malcolm Walker, Erica Hayes and Edwina Harvey. Damien Kane talks about what makes his writing tick, and Stephen Turner leads us further along the Hero's Journey. There's another two editions of the humorous flash fiction series by Yusuf Martin.

And of course there's Satima's amazing reviews section, which even Australian publishers read. It's said by some to be the best reviews section in an Australian web magazine.

There's something for everybody at The Specusphere.

Volunteers

We are always on the lookout for volunteers, be it to help edit the reviews, proofread articles, start a new section or take over an old one. How about taking charge of our news desk? What about running this bulletin? Or writing editorials? Or being a blog liaison person — now there's a job for an enterprising editor.

Readers have recently suggested we:

a.. Create the capacity for readers to comment on articles
b.. Have a regular comic section
c.. Have a gallery page for artists and graphic designers

Yes, we'd like to do all the above, but we need people to turn the idea into
something practical.

Next issue: 4 April 2010
